First, consider the arrangement of your laundry room. Effective use of space is key, notably in more compact areas. I noticed that stacking the washer and dryer can open up floor space, providing me space for extra storage or a folding station. Should space allows, adding a countertop above adjacent appliances creates a handy surface for folding clothes right out of the dryer.

Storage is another essential element to think about. Cabinets and shelves help organize cleaning supplies, detergents, and other items organized and easily accessible. In my experience, employing tagged baskets or bins on open shelves gives a organized, cohesive look while keeping everything in its place. In case your laundry room has limited space, wall-mounted cabinets can provide additional storage that doesn’t require important floor space.

Adding a sink to your laundry room might be a major improvement. It’s ideal for handwashing special care items or pre-treating stains ahead of washing. Should plumbing is feasible, I suggest adding a deep utility sink that is capable of handling more significant tasks, like soaking items or cleaning tools.

Lighting also has a crucial role in making the space functional. Adequate task lighting guarantees you have visibility what you’re handling when separating, folding, or treating stains. Under-cabinet lighting is a effective option for lighting up work surfaces, while a ceiling fixture can offer ambient lighting for the room.

Finally, don’t forget to inject some personality into your laundry room. A fresh coat of paint, fun wallpaper, or decorative accents could make the space feel more pleasant. I like bringing in touches like artwork, plants, or even a stylish rug to bring warmth and character to the room.
